CV Screening and Candidate Matching
The average UK recruitment consultant spends 23 hours per week screening CVs — that's nearly 60% of their working time on a task AI can do in seconds.
How AI matching works:
- Analyses job requirements against candidate profiles (not just keyword matching, but understanding skills equivalence and career progression)
- Considers factors humans miss: transferable skills, career trajectory, cultural fit indicators, availability patterns
- Ranks candidates by match quality with explanation — so consultants understand the reasoning
- Learns from your placement history — which matches led to successful placements and which didn't
Results: Agencies using AI matching report 40-60% reduction in time-to-shortlist and 25% improvement in placement success rates.
Candidate Sourcing
Finding candidates in a tight labour market is brutal. AI helps by:
Database mining: AI searches your existing database (which probably contains thousands of candidates you've forgotten about) and surfaces relevant matches for new roles. Most agencies find 20-30% of placements come from reactivated database candidates.
Multi-platform search: AI simultaneously searches LinkedIn, job boards, GitHub, and professional networks to identify passive candidates who match your requirements.
Engagement prediction: AI predicts which candidates are likely to be open to new opportunities based on tenure, company performance, and market signals — so you approach them at the right time.
Pipeline Automation
The recruitment pipeline has dozens of manual touchpoints that AI can automate:
Candidate communication: Application acknowledgements, interview scheduling, feedback delivery, and status updates — all automated with personalised, professional messaging.
Interview scheduling: AI coordinates availability between candidates, clients, and interviewers. No more email ping-pong. Calendar integration handles the logistics automatically.
Compliance and right-to-work: AI verifies documents, tracks expiry dates, and ensures compliance with employment regulations. Essential for agencies placing in regulated sectors.
Reference checking: Automated reference requests and follow-ups, with AI analysis of responses to flag concerns.
Client Management
AI also enhances the client side of your business:
- Job spec analysis: AI reviews job descriptions and suggests improvements based on what attracts quality candidates in your market
- Market intelligence: Salary benchmarking, availability analysis, and competitor insights generated automatically for client conversations
- Client reporting: Automated weekly/monthly reports on recruitment activity, pipeline status, and market conditions
- Relationship scoring: AI tracks client engagement and flags accounts that need attention before relationships go cold

Is AI matching better than keyword searching?
Significantly. Keyword search misses candidates who describe their experience differently. AI understands that "people management" and "team leadership" are related skills, that a "senior developer" might be suitable for a "tech lead" role, and other nuances that simple search can't handle.
What about bias in AI recruitment?
AI can perpetuate bias if trained on biased historical data. Choose tools that are regularly audited for bias, offer explainable matching decisions, and comply with the UK's Equality Act 2010. Good AI recruitment tools actively reduce bias by focusing on skills and experience rather than demographic factors.
